Dance Saturdays
South Plaza, 2 - 4pm
Presented by Dance 4U.
Free dance lessons and social dancing for all skill levels. Salsa, Swing, Rumba, Cha-Cha, Bachata, Tango, Merengue.
Class format: 2pm demo, 2:30 open dancing focusing on lesson style dance with other requests mixed in, 3pm demo and lesson, 3:30pm open dancing until 4pm.

Every Saturday ~ 10am - 3pm on the East Plaza
Conventional and organic produce, jam, jelly, vinegar, salsa, sauces, baking, honey, maple syrup, tea, eggs, local artisans with pottery, wood work, jewellery, soap and live music. The Farmers Market also features a book swap, kids play area and featured entertainment.
